About 1-methyl-6-methylidenecyclohexene

1-methyl-6-methylidenecyclohexene (PubChem CID 13048025) has the molecular formula C8H12 and a molecular weight of 108.18 g/mol. Its IUPAC name is 1-methyl-6-methylidenecyclohexene.
